    PIRATES COVE TUNA ROUNDUP ROLL CALL

    The Pirates Cove Tuna Roundup is coming up the weekend after Memorial Day. The Captain's Meeting is Thursday night, June 2, and the Tournament Days are Fri & Sat, June 3 & 4. We are fishing on FIRST CRACK and have buddies fishing on SEA TOY, BI-OP-SEA, COUNTRY GIRL & OBSESSION. Anyone else on here fishing it? How about Bob on STILL THINK'N and the other boats from Virginia Beach?
